Coaxial rf cable is the most commonly used structure. Due to the concentric position of the inner and outer conductors, electromagnetic energy is confined to the medium between the inner and outer conductors. Therefore, it has significant advantages such as small attenuation, high shielding performance, wide frequency band and stable performance. It is usually used to transmit radio frequency energy from 500 KHZ to 18 gigahertz.
